🌍 What Is Highway?
Highway is a popular snack made from ripe plantains, often enjoyed in various cultures. Its name reflects its quick and easy preparation, making it a favorite on the go. With a crispy exterior and a soft, flavorful interior, it's a must-try for plantain lovers!
🧾 Ingredients
**Base:**
- 3 ripe plantains (not overripe)
- 1 large onion
- Salt (to taste)
- Oil (for frying)
**Optional:**
- Spices (e.g., pepper, garlic powder) for added flavor
👩🍳 Step-by-Step Instructions
1. **Prepare the Plantains:**
- Peel the ripe plantains and cut them into small pieces.
- Smash the pieces gently to flatten them, but not too thin.
2. **Shred the Onion:**
- Finely shred about half of the large onion. Be careful, as the strong aroma may cause tears!
3. **Mix Ingredients:**

- In a bowl, combine the smashed plantains, shredded onion, and salt.
- Mix well to ensure the flavors are evenly distributed.
4. **Heat the Oil:**
- In a pot, heat enough oil for frying. Ensure the oil is warm but not smoking to prevent burning the plantains.
5. **Fry the Plantains:**
- Carefully add the plantain mixture to the hot oil, ensuring not to overcrowd the pot.
- Fry until golden brown, turning occasionally to prevent burning.
6. **Remove and Shape:**
- Once fried, remove the plantains from the oil and let them drain on paper towels.
- While still warm, mold them into desired shapes (like small meatballs) using your hands or a mold.
7. **Final Fry (Optional):**
- For extra crispiness, you can return the shaped plantains to the oil for a second fry.
🍽️ How to Serve
Serve your Highway plantain snacks warm, garnished with a sprinkle of salt. They can be enjoyed on their own or paired with dipping sauces like spicy mayo or salsa for an extra kick!
💡 Pro Tips
- Use just ripe plantains to avoid them soaking up too much oil.
- Keep an eye on the frying process to prevent burning; remove them as soon as they turn golden brown.
